React Native

Componenti e API di React Native

TouchableOpacity, TextInput, Modal, ActivityIndicator, Platform, Dimensions, StatusBar

20 domande da colloquio·
Junior
1

Quale componente dovrebbe essere usato per creare un semplice pulsante con un effetto di trasparenza al tocco?

Risposta

TouchableOpacity è il componente standard per creare pulsanti con un effetto visivo di trasparenza al tocco. Quando l'utente lo preme, l'opacità del contenuto diminuisce temporaneamente, fornendo un feedback visivo immediato. È il componente più comunemente usato per semplici interazioni tattili in React Native.

2

Quale prop di TextInput consente di nascondere il testo inserito, utile per i campi password?

Risposta

La prop secureTextEntry nasconde il testo inserito mostrando punti o asterischi al posto dei caratteri. È il metodo standard per creare campi password sicuri in React Native. Quando è abilitata, il testo non è visibile sullo schermo e gli appunti sono solitamente disabilitati per motivi di sicurezza.

3

Come recuperare il valore inserito in un TextInput in modo controllato?

Risposta

Un TextInput controllato combina la prop value con il callback onChangeText. La prop value definisce il testo visualizzato ed è collegata a uno state di React. onChangeText viene chiamato a ogni modifica con il nuovo valore, consentendo di aggiornare lo state. Questo pattern garantisce un'unica fonte di verità e consente la validazione o la trasformazione del testo in tempo reale.

4

Qual è la principale differenza tra TouchableOpacity e Pressable?

5

Come visualizzare un indicatore di caricamento centrato sullo schermo?

+17 domande da colloquio

Padroneggia React Native per il tuo prossimo colloquio

Accedi a tutte le domande, flashcards, test tecnici, esercizi di code review e simulatori di colloquio.

Inizia gratis